Iodine is a non-metallic, dark-gray or bluish-black, lustrous solid element. It forms compounds with many elements, but least reactive than the other halogens. Iodine is a naturally occurring element found in sea water and in certain rocks and sediments. There are non radioactive and radioactive forms of iodine. Iodine is used as a disinfectant for cleaning surfaces and storage containers and is used in skin soaps and bandages, and for purifying water. x3TWIL.
